Subject: Autofarm boom control and JD 6700


I have a 6700 sprayer with a 3 section boom control. I would like to use the autofarm boom section control but use 6 sections. This would allow me to control 6 - 10' sections. Has anyone tried this? I know I will need to have more valves but will the G* have any problems with this. It will only allow 3 sections so how will I be able to control 6. I think it will work by bypassing the 3 section part but will the G* then be able to adjust for speed and rate? My rep will be at my farm next week but not sure if has done this.
